THE GARAGE (Clarion Campus)
Sundays 6:00 pm to 8:00 pm - high energy, fun and a whole lot more

These evenings generate an atmosphere of excitement and encouragement for large groups of high school students and creates for them the ideal place to connect with God and friends. Students have an all access pass to the recreation center that has booths, cafe' tables, televisions, pool, air hockey and Internet access. Students can choose to play at any of four video game stations with Xbox360, Wii, Playstation3, GameCube and Dance Pad systems. The Pit Stop snack shop serves hot dogs, nachos, pretzels, Slush Puppies, cappuccinos and candy. Students will also attend a worship service where live contemporary music, multimedia and dramas set the stage for a time of relevant teaching and worship.

MISSION ADVENTURES
a ministry experience like no other

Every summer the junior and senior high students of Zion have the opportunity to experience first hand what life is like outside their comfort zone. They can see God at work in a place that looks nothing like home. These trips allow God to challenge and stretch them to do more than they have ever done before for His glory. The trip is a time to serve and minister instead of being served.
